Getting a pet could be a fantastic thing particularly if it is a canine, man’s best friend so they say. Getting a doggie though can be a lifetime commitment, they may appear all cute and wonderful when they are a new puppy, and they quickly grow and have undesirable habits, equally as awful as an baby.
In some circumstances however, pet owners just cannot cope with a brand new dog, because of its behavior, or even their working hrs are getting in the way, and occasionally the price. Not a lot of people consider the price associated with having this kind of a pet, the very first lot of injections required the month-to-month worming and flea treatment, insurances, and food. Nevertheless for all those who’re committed and understand that they may be going to be issues to conquer it could be a joy.
When a new puppy is taken from it’s mother, that ought to be after 8 weeks and never before, and placed in a new house they are going to be very puzzled. Not merely have they been taken away from their mother and siblings, but there can be new sounds and smells to deal with as well. Permitting the new puppy to explore the home initially is important, you should be prepared for little puddles and maybe a poo or even two. They will not have a lot of energy to explore for very long, so making sure that a special area which has a bed is already been made up for them, so they are able to sleep.

The very first couple of evenings may be a lttle bit of a challenge, as they do have a tendency to yowl quite a lot, they have never been left alone previously. A lot of people use dog cages within the first couple of months for the puppy to rest within, and it may be advisable to place this in a bed room, exactly where the puppy can still notice that a person is there. Over time the crate can be moved further and further away until it is inside the preferred place that you simply wish the puppy to stay, for instance the conservatory or even the kitchen utility room.
It is essential to begin training the puppy exactly where to go to the toilet. If the breeder where you purchased the puppy from was excellent, they would have already began this procedure of taking them outdoors. Make sure you take them out frequently and reward once they carry out their business. It may be very best not to clean away what they have done straight away, as it will leave a scent for them, so that they recognize exactly where to go next time. It may be very best to obtain a dog doors set up. Teach the puppy how to go in and out of it, with doggie snacks and plenty of encouragement.
Getting a doggie door set up is perfect for whenever you must leave the dog to go to work, or if you are going shopping. They can allow themselves out to the lawn, play as well as do their business, with out doing it all over your flooring. There are numerous types of doggie doors obtainable to accommodate any sort of door or even canine you could possess.
By training your puppy you are able to make sure that they are going to develop to become a great canine as well as a life long friend.
The Centers for Disease Control eliminated Leptospirosis from the “reportable human diseases” list, there is, however, still significant concern about this zoonotic disease. Our pets are at risk of lepto as well, however, many owners are afraid to vaccinate for the illness. What’s the true story and just how can we continue to keep our pets and families safe?
Mary Fleming always followed the advice of her veterinarian when it came to her miniature poodle, Mitsie. Regular examinations, heartworm preventive and even a good diet helped keep Mitsie active and healthy. Thinking that Mitsie was safe, Mary did not opt for a Leptospirosis vaccine for her dog. Unfortunately, Mitsie got very sick not long after visiting her city’s dog park and needed intensive care and hospitalization. Thankfully, her veterinarian was there to help her recover and explain how moist soil or puddles at the park actually put Mitsie at risk!
Leptospirosis is a zoonotic disease- a disease that can be passed between animals and people. It is spread by spirochete (spiral-shaped) bacteria in the urine of infected rodents, wildlife, and pets. There are more than 200 different strains of lepto and certain strains appear to prefer certain hosts, like dogs, pigs, raccoons or even rats.
The leptospira organisms enter the body through mucous membranes or through abrasions on the skin. People and animals can become infected from direct exposure to infected urine, but also through contaminated environment, such as water or damp soil.
People and pets are also exposed to Lepto while camping or participating in outdoor recreational activities. Drinking or swimming in water that is infected with Lepto is the most common exposure, but wet soil can be contaminated as well. And, as Mitsie’s case illustrates, a city environment will not always provide protection against this serious disease.

The signs of Leptospirosis can mimic many other diseases and illnesses. The first signs in dogs are often depression, loss of appetite, vomiting, weakness, and generalized pain. Affected dogs may also drink water and urinate excessively and have swollen, red, and painful eyes. Because these signs are common to other diseases and non-specific, owners may try to treat their pets at home for such problems as an upset stomach or arthritis.
This “wait and see” response delays proper diagnosis and treatment for the dog, as well as increasing the owner’s exposure to the disease. If caught early, treatment is usually effective and the survival rate is good. However, time is of the essence. A mere three or four day delay can lead to irreversible kidney failure.
Vaccines are available but many pet owners, like Mary above, have either experienced or heard about adverse reactions associated with these vaccines. In the past, Leptospirosis vaccines were generally created using the whole bacterial organism. In many cases, when a whole bacterium is used, the likelihood of a “vaccine reaction” increases. Thankfully, newer vaccines have been developed that reduce this possibility by using specific Leptospirosis proteins instead of the whole organism.
A study reviewing vaccine reactions in more than one million dogs vaccinated found that reactions occur about 13 times for every 10,000 vaccines given. More importantly, the lepto vaccine was no more likely to cause a reaction than any other vaccine.
So, if the vaccine appears to be safe and the disease deadly, shouldn’t all dog owners vaccinate their pets?
Unfortunately, that question is difficult to fully answer. Because there are so many Leptospirosis strains, no one vaccine will cover every possible exposure a pet might have. At present, vaccines are available that protect against four of the common strains infecting dogs. In addition, the vaccine will prevent clinical disease, but may not stop the pet from shedding bacteria in his urine. This makes the pet a threat to other animals, especially those who are not vaccinated. And, as mentioned above, humans are at risk as well.
Worldwide, Leptospirosis is the most widespread zoonotic disease. Cases occur routinely in tropical countries, but increases have been seen in Europe and North America as well. Floods and hurricanes are instrumental in spreading this illness and coordinated efforts to rescue and re-home pets from these disasters might actually transplant lepto into new areas.
Protecting your pet from Leptospirosis is a complex situation. Use your veterinarian as a resource to help assess your pet’s risk factors as well as the benefits and hazards of vaccination. Other important steps that might minimize your pet’s exposure to this disease include removing animal pests, such as rodents and draining areas of standing water.
